Responsibilities

In this role, you will be the technical lead for FPGA development supporting our airborne radar products, establishing the foundation for FPGA design processes and best practices.

You will be responsible for translating algorithmic requirements into FPGA implementations, leading signal processing design efforts, and collaborating with our Costa Mesa team to ensure seamless integration across projects.

This will require expertise in FPGA design, signal processing, RTL development (SystemVerilog/VHDL), and Xilinx toolchains.

If you are a self-directed technical leader who thrives on establishing new capabilities and can take an algorithm document and independently drive it through to hardware implementation, then this role is for you.

Lead FPGA architecture, design, and verification efforts for airborne radar systems from concept through production

Translate signal processing algorithms into efficient, high-performance FPGA implementations on Xilinx SOC/FPGA platforms

Team

The Battlespace Awareness (BA) team develops state-of-the-art radar systems, deployed to tackle the most significant security challenges of America and its allies. Working across hardware, software, and firmware; in both the RF and digital domains; the team delivers radar architectures that enable advanced surveillance, reconnaissance, and targeting in the contemporary and future battlespace. The Radar team is responsible for all aspects of radar system development; from concepts and architectures through to fielding and sustainment. In this role, you will work closely with an interdisciplinary technical team to define radar architectures, design solutions, build prototypes, perform testing, and mature the prototypes into products.
